Bhagwat Kishanrao Karad is an Indian politician belonging to the Bharatiya Janata Party. He is a member of the Rajya Sabha the upper house of Indian Parliament from Maharashtra. He was the Mayor of Aurangabad twice.[1][2][3] He is an organisational person of the Bharatiya Janata Party of Maharashtra from Aurangabad.
He became Minister of State in the Ministry of Finance in the reshuffle of PM Modi's cabinet in the second term.[4]
